Fenton is a locality in Genesee County, Michigan, United States. It has a population of 11,906. The population density is 693.7 people per km². Fenton is located at 42.7978°N, 83.7049°W. It observes the Eastern Time (America/Detroit) timezone. ZIP code: 48430.

It lies 13.8 miles west-south-west of Brandon Township, MI (from Brandon Township, MI: bearing 254°T), and is situated 9.7 miles south-south-west of Grand Blanc.
